HSE completes purchase of east Donegal residence

written by Staff Writer March 20, 2022
FacebookTweetLinkedInPrint

The HSE has recently completed the purchase of a €300,000 house and lands in the east of the county.

The five-bedroom home is set on 3.3 acres at Cavan Lower, Killygordon, just off the main N15 Stranorlar to Lifford road.

It is located less than a mile from Stranorlar.

Local auctioneer, Martin McGowan Properties, had the property on the market with a €335,000 asking price.

The HSE has recently erected ‘No Trespassing’ signs on the gates of the house.

The property recently purchase by the HSE at Cavan Lower, Killygordon. Pic: Martin McGowan Properties.

 

The red brick home, set on a large level site with mature trees and shrubs includes a study, three bathrooms, three reception rooms and stables.

“This property has space in abundance, both inside and out – rarely does such a fine residence come to the market,” the sales literature stated.
